Output 24acc428226926a9db1423af0edb78900f35be06fbab992ccdb2edeb8d406b76:1

value
19800560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7450734315650c8ce70042dd1a33a43f4b1b4e9 OP_EQUAL
address
3Nmri1sYLQJeyQmMbisyDHvfX3ahtv1Bg6
transaction
24acc428226926a9db1423af0edb78900f35be06fbab992ccdb2edeb8d406b76
spent
true